Vegetative propagation is the reproduction of a plant from a fragment, or piece, of the parent plant. This can occur through fragmentation and regeneration of specific vegetative parts of plants. Vegetative propagation is a form of asexual reproduction in plants where new individuals develop from specialized structures of the parent plant, such as stems, leaves, or roots, without the involvement of seeds.
